Recipe: Grilled Chicken with Lemon and Herb Marinade

Ingredients:

4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

1/4 cup olive oil

1/4 cup fresh lemon juice

2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ley

2 tablespoons chopped fresh thyme

2 tablespoons chopped fresh rosemary

2 cloves garlic, minced

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

In a b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, parsley, thyme, rosemary, garlic, salt, and pepper until well combined.

Place the chicken breasts in a shallow dish and pour the marinade over the chicken, turning to coat evenly.

Cover the dish with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 4 hours) to allow the flavors to meld.

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.

Remove the chicken from the marinade and discard any remaining marinade.

Grill the chicken for 6-8 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.

Rem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for 5 minutes before slicing and serving.

Nutritional Benefits:

This grilled chicken recipe is not only delicious, but also packed with essential nutrients that are good for your health. Chicken is a great source of protein, which is important for building and repairing tissues in the body. It also contains important vitamins and minerals like B vitamins, phosphorus, and selenium. The lemon and herb marinade adds a burst of flavor and also provides additional nutritional benefits. Lemon juice is high in vitamin C, which supports immune function and helps your body absorb iron from plant-based foods. Herbs like parsley, thyme, and rosemary are rich in antioxidants, which can help protect against chronic diseases like cancer and heart disease.

Variations and Serving Suggestions:

One of the great things about this recipe is its versatility. You can easily customize the marinade to suit your taste preferences by adjusting the amount of herbs or lemon juice. You can also try using different herbs like basil, oregano, or sage to switch up the flavor profile. Serve the grilled chicken with a side salad, roasted vegetables, or a whole grain like quinoa or brown rice for a complete and balanced meal.
